Meleonoma tenuiuncata sp. nov.
(Figs. 8, 24)
Type material. CHINA, Guangxi: Holotype ♂, Hekou (24.14°N, 110.09°E), Mt. Dayao, Jinxiu, 823 m, 20.VII.2015, leg. MJ Qi & SN Zhao, slide No. YAH15410.
Diagnosis. The new species is similar to M. polychaeta Li, 2004 in the male genitalia. It can be distinguished by the valva with distal 1/4 equally narrow, the saccus elongate triangular, and the stout aedeagus wider than the valva in the male genitalia. In M. polychaeta, the valva is gradually narrowed to apex, the saccus short broad triangular, and the slender aedeagus is narrower than the valva (Li & Wang 2004: 35, Fig. 4).
Description. Adult (Fig. 8). Forewing length 4.3 mm.
Head yellowish white. Labial palpus yellowish white; second segment with a greyish brown ring apically; third segment with a greyish brown spot at middle dorsally, shorter than second segment. Antenna yellowish white, flagellum annulated with greyish brown on dorsal surface except basal several flagellomeres yellow.
Thorax yellowish white (worn); tegula greyish brown, yellowish white distally. Forewing with costal margin arched, apex rounded; ground color yellow, costal margin with more black scales in basal 2/5, forming an ill-defined narrow stripe; costal spot greyish brown, inverted triangular, situated beyond middle; apical patch greyish black, large; tornal spot greyish black, smaller, narrowly diffused to apical patch along termen; discal and plical spots black, almost equally sized; discocellular spots blackish grey, small; dorsum with a black spot at base, consisting of a few black scales; fringe greyish black, with a yellow basal line interrupted by greyish black scales. Hindwing and fringe greyish black. Legs yellow (worn); on ventral surface, mid femur as well as tibiae of fore- and midlegs marked with greyish brown scales.
Male genitalia (Fig. 24). Uncus slender, slightly narrowed to pointed apex. Tegumen inverted V shaped; lateral arm rounded anteriorly. Valva sub-rectangular, with dense setae basally, slightly curved at distal 1/4 on dorsal margin, equally narrow from distal 1/4 to apex, forming a rounded distal process with tufted dense long setae and numerous short spines; ventral margin heavily sclerotized, forming a narrow band, linked with dorsoapex of sacculus; costa slightly convex beyond middle; transtilla band shaped, almost meeting medially. Sacculus sub-triangular; apex obliquely inward, bearing dense short setae; ventral margin short. Saccus wide basally, narrowed distally, rounded at apex; shorter than uncus. Juxta circular.Aedeagus 1.5 times as long as valva; distal 4/5 with a slender bar ventrally, with a large, sclerotized, tubular process dorsally.
Female unknown.
Distribution. China (Guangxi).
Etymology. The specific epithet is derived from the Latin tenu - and uncatus, referring to the slender uncus.
